#326649 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#326649 is composed of 19.6% red, 40%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51% cyan, 0% magenta, 28.4%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 146.5 degrees, a saturation of 34.2% and a lightness of 29.8%. #326649 color hex could be obtained by blending #64cc92 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#326649
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050a07 is the darkest color, while #fcfd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#326649
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#494f4c is the less saturated color, while #039544 is the most saturated one.
